I do it that way:

- create a file pass.rules in your rules directory and add any pass rule you
wish, e.g.
pass tcp [1.2.3.4/32] any -> any 80
- add option -o to the snort command line

For more information on that take a look at the Snort User's Manual where
this is described in detail

Hi
We are using Snort1.8.3 with mysql and demarc.We need to 
ignore some packets based on their ips,ie.,write some pass 
rules.Where do you place these rules and how do you configure 
snort for the same.Could somebody help us out.
